PLC-求助老菜鸟工程师 点击:1118 | 回复:19



123456girl

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 13回
  • 年度积分:0
  • 历史总积分:22
  • 注册:2009年4月21日
发表于:2009-04-29 13:11:41
楼主
我的控制要求是这样的:钢管以一定的速度运行,当钢管运行到一定长度时,锯车启动加速度,当追至与管速相同时,二者以相同速度运行,当达到设定钢管长度时,锯车与钢管在无相对运动的情况下锯片落下切割钢管。切割完毕后,锯片抬起,锯车返回原味停止,等待下次切割。锯车和钢管的位置通过测速滚和脉冲编码器检测。此外还用到了D/A模块,高速计数器和变频器。手动程序我已经编好了,现在需要编自动和模拟的子程序以及如何调用这些子程序的主程序。编码器2000/r,测速滚每转一周移动距离为S=400mm/r 。对于自动控制程序的编写,有很多不明白的地方,模拟量的编程课上根本没有讲过,所以想问一下这个控制过程的模拟量编程。谢谢



euro2008

  • 精华:4帖
  • 求助:0帖
  • 帖子:228帖 | 12358回
  • 年度积分:2963
  • 历史总积分:29795
  • 注册:2004年4月26日
发表于:2009-04-29 20:43:52
1楼

具体PLC是什么?

应该不是很复杂

老菜鸟

  • 精华:22帖
  • 求助:0帖
  • 帖子:301帖 | 8609回
  • 年度积分:0
  • 历史总积分:24924
  • 注册:2003年6月15日
发表于:2009-05-02 20:32:35
2楼

1、编码器的信号给PLC,PLC检测钢管和锯车的运动速度,锯车的速度通过PID控制方式与钢管速度一致。如果钢管的速度可以预置(分成几个固定的速度而不是连续可调的那种),那么建议直接给定锯车速度而不要采用PID。

2、不知道两者的运行速度大概是个什么范围,多少米/分钟?如果钢管和锯车的速度过高而且运行距离很短,实现起来比较麻烦,因为也需要一个加速时间和稳定时间。

3、2个编码器直接接到PLC的高速输入就可以了,S7-200就可以搞定。

4、D/A模块按硬件参考电路接线,程序里面不需要什么设置,直接给定就可以了。不过需要知道D/A模块是多少位的。

5、编码器的脉冲信号转换为线速度,需要进行数学运算,你需要知道传动比、什么传动轮的节圆直径等等。

6、这个程序里面看起来很简单,但还是有很多东西会涉及到。如果有需要的话,你可以参阅我发过的帖子。

老菜鸟

  • 精华:22帖
  • 求助:0帖
  • 帖子:301帖 | 8609回
  • 年度积分:0
  • 历史总积分:24924
  • 注册:2003年6月15日
发表于:2009-05-02 20:34:20
3楼

帖子如下:

西门子S7-200系列PLC的PID功能块的应用经验 http://www.gongkong.com/Forum/ForumTopic.aspx?Id=3-83F9-2F15B5D01D2C

提供下载:两条生产线同步控制系统 http://www.gongkong.com/Forum/ForumTopic.aspx?Id=A-BE44-418B8D4C2AF8

S7-200同步控制:PID位置环的设定值为零的解决方案实例 http://www.gongkong.com/Forum/ForumTopic.aspx?Id=2008060609012500001

里面有程序下载,你可以看看相关PLC程序,对你或许有一些帮助。

123456girl

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 13回
  • 年度积分:0
  • 历史总积分:22
  • 注册:2009年4月21日
发表于:2009-05-04 14:28:36
4楼
我用的是西门子的,cpuc226.我现在一点头绪都没有,能不能给点思路。谢谢大家

alexyht

  • 精华:0帖
  • 求助:0帖
  • 帖子:4帖 | 107回
  • 年度积分:0
  • 历史总积分:151
  • 注册:2003年11月15日
发表于:2009-05-04 14:36:46
5楼

新手写不出这个程序的

 

robotH

  • 精华:0帖
  • 求助:0帖
  • 帖子:7帖 | 688回
  • 年度积分:0
  • 历史总积分:2433
  • 注册:2004年10月14日
发表于:2009-05-04 15:40:58
6楼
追剪程序。不好实现,特别是用变频器控制锯车。要保证锯车速度与钢管同步时正好到达切口位置,不仅仅是速度同步问题。

深水渔

  • 精华:0帖
  • 求助:1帖
  • 帖子:32帖 | 1660回
  • 年度积分:0
  • 历史总积分:1915
  • 注册:2007年12月17日
发表于:2009-05-04 15:50:54
7楼

用317T 的CPU吧.............

kisspp

  • 精华:0帖
  • 求助:0帖
  • 帖子:8帖 | 79回
  • 年度积分:0
  • 历史总积分:67
  • 注册:2008年12月16日
发表于:2009-05-11 10:37:38
8楼

如果距离短真的不好实现,要同步之前要有稳定时间~距离短就…………

yunlai

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 57回
  • 年度积分:0
  • 历史总积分:135
  • 注册:2002年11月19日
发表于:2009-05-11 16:16:48
9楼
我是这样想,大家看行不行。铜管的速度是一定的,那么可以实时确定切口的位置,根据锯车与切口的距离作类似PID的计算来确定锯车速度,直到锯车与铜管同步。

44yanzhi

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 57回
  • 年度积分:0
  • 历史总积分:226
  • 注册:2009年4月22日
发表于:2009-05-11 16:41:18
10楼
能否这样控制,锯车的行车机构分二种方式。有固定的原点,铜管长度到达是与铜管前进的机构一起同步前进切割,割完后与前进机构分离,再由另一装置带动返回原点。

边干边学

  • 精华:1帖
  • 求助:0帖
  • 帖子:1帖 | 344回
  • 年度积分:0
  • 历史总积分:401
  • 注册:2008年12月04日
发表于:2009-05-11 18:26:09
11楼

选型严重错误:

1、追剪系统是频繁往复运动,采用变频器控制则交流电机容易烧毁;而且锯车加大时很难控制惯性。

2、系统不仅要求速度同步,而且要求定位精确,变频无法达到精度;

3、只能用于低速和精度要求很低的场合,

当钢管的速度提升后,因为变频器+编码器系统属于被动的控制方式,无法完成准确的加速和减速脉冲数控制。

综上所说,您需要选择伺服电机而且加位置反馈回上位机做数据处理。

边干边学

  • 精华:1帖
  • 求助:0帖
  • 帖子:1帖 | 344回
  • 年度积分:0
  • 历史总积分:401
  • 注册:2008年12月04日
发表于:2009-05-11 18:32:56
12楼
哦,对了,如果是课程设计或者毕业设计,是可以采用DA模块来控制变频器来做的。

123456girl

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 13回
  • 年度积分:0
  • 历史总积分:22
  • 注册:2009年4月21日
发表于:2009-05-13 13:55:42
13楼
对,我就是采用DA模块来控制变频器的,可是程序不是很会。有没有可以帮忙的?谢谢大家

九灭重生

  • 精华:0帖
  • 求助:0帖
  • 帖子:14帖 | 175回
  • 年度积分:0
  • 历史总积分:130
  • 注册:2007年4月04日
发表于:2009-05-14 17:09:20
14楼

我感觉别的都好说,主要像8楼和11楼说的,什么时候起动能保证锯车和变频同步时又可以满足钢管的长度,我咨询过我的老师,他以前做过,他说不用PID就可以,可还是想不明白.

高渐飞

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 101回
  • 年度积分:0
  • 历史总积分:426
  • 注册:2002年4月07日
发表于:2009-05-15 11:49:01
15楼

这个问题不是那么简单的,2006年时,Danfoss给我讲过他们的变频器的一个使用工程,和楼主的要求完全一样,这里必须使用变频器的同步控制功能,难度不在PLC的控制,而是变频器的同步控制。

   这和PID没任何关系。由编码器检测位置,由同步卡控制两电机的最终同步,而同步的条件是位置检测达到要求(即达到长度要求,可以开始切割),否则属于加速阶段。

123456girl

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 13回
  • 年度积分:0
  • 历史总积分:22
  • 注册:2009年4月21日
发表于:2009-05-16 10:40:26
16楼

大家如有知道此程序的,麻烦发到我邮箱里,谢谢大家。

yanruigirl@163.com

吴贤群

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 94回
  • 年度积分:0
  • 历史总积分:254
  • 注册:2007年10月08日
发表于:2009-05-20 10:05:10
17楼

SIEMA品牌PC/PPI通讯电缆(6SM7 901-3CB30带光电隔离)特价销售,每条仅售180元。
PC/PPI通讯电缆安全可靠,屏蔽性强,使用简单,即插即用,广大客户可以轻松使用。

SIEMA品牌SM7-300系列PLC专用24V电源(6SM7 307-1EA00)特价销售,每只仅售500元。
SM7-300系列PLC专用24V电源输出恒定,抗干扰能力强,与西门子同类产品功能完全相同,即插即用,广大客户可以轻松使用。

网站:www.siemat.net

 

上海菱新机电 编程电缆特价

  • 精华:0帖
  • 求助:0帖
  • 帖子:12帖 | 241回
  • 年度积分:0
  • 历史总积分:393
  • 注册:2007年4月26日
发表于:2009-05-20 10:21:28
18楼

学习

 

 

 

www.plcdl.com PLC编程电缆网 QQ:821988027

无语

  • 精华:0帖
  • 求助:0帖
  • 帖子:3帖 | 57回
  • 年度积分:0
  • 历史总积分:154
  • 注册:2007年4月26日
发表于:2009-05-28 23:15:32
19楼

( ^_^ )不错嘛  学习  学习


热门招聘
相关主题

官方公众号

智造工程师